Scalable Coherent Interface (SCI) is an innovative interconnect
standard (ANSI/IEEE Std 1596-1992) addressing the high-performance
computing and networking domain. This book describes in depth one
specific application of SCI: its use as a high-speed
interconnection network (often called a system area network, SAN)
for compute clusters built from commodity workstation nodes. The
editors and authors, coming from both academia and industry, have
been instrumental in the SCI standardization process, the
development and deployment of SCI adapter cards, switches, fully
integrated clusters, and software systems, and are closely involved
in various research projects on this important interconnect. This
thoroughly cross-reviewed state-of-the-art survey covers the
complete hardware/software spectrum of SCI clusters, from the major
concepts of SCI, through SCI hardware, networking, and low-level
software issues, various programming models and environments, up to
tools and application experiences.
